hey, i was wondering if you know anything about Nissans acknowledgement of this HID theft problem?

This problem is solely responsible for the decrease in price of the 2k2 - 2k3 maximas in the NY area. If i drive around NYC for 8 hours straight, there is a good chance i will see at least 2 or 3.. 2k2+ maximas with a missing headlight or headlights from a 2000 or 2001 max.

I can purchase a 2k2 maxima with 20k miles for around 16k now! this is crazy.
